The
American Institute of Certified Public Accountants (AICPA) Peer Review Program requires
that CPA firms, who have accounting or auditing practice in the United States or
its territories, submit to an approved practice‑monitoring program. When CPAs
prepare or assist in preparing financial statements, they are required under professional
standards to issue a report on those financial statements. A report may be one of
three kinds: audit report, review report, or compilation report. Once the report
is issued, a Peer Review of that report is conducted. Peer Review is an outside
review, performed by another accounting firm on a tri‑annual basis.
The Peer Review program is dedicated to enhancing the quality of accounting, auditing
and attestation services.
